C20 Ceramide
C20 Ceramide (N-Arachidoyl-D-sphingosine) is a saturated 20:0 ceramide present in brain tissue. It is capable of crossing the blood-brain barrier, where it activates microglia and promotes depressive-like behaviors in preclinical models, making it a relevant tool for neuroinflammation and psychiatric disorder research.
